Question: Can I buy only the emergency evacuation coverage and not the medical insurance?

Answer: 

Technically it is possible to do this; however, we would advise you to purchase an evacuation plan with high deductible medical coverage. The reason for this is twofold. Firstly, an international health insurance plan with emergency evacuation and a high deductible will assure you that you will be evacuated should anything untoward happen while you are overseas. Secondly, having an international medical insurance plan means that you will be able to receive high quality treatment outside of the emergency evacuation coverage.

International medical insurance plans with a high deductible are commonly referred to as “catastrophe plans”; because the high deductible means that they are impractical for everyday use. Having a higher deductible will lessen the overall cost of the plan while giving you the same coverage benefits that everyone else has. Basically, if you purchase a high deductible plan with emergency evacuation cover, you may find that it is not feasible to use the plan for any benefit other than emergency evacuation. This means however, that you will be paying less than if the plan had a low deductible.
